In first, Iraq detains pro-Iran fighters accused of anti-US rockets

Baghdad (AFP) – Iraqi security forces had been Friday interrogating professional-Iran fighters detained for arranging a rocket assault in the first these types of raid in a nation caught in the tug-of-war concerning Tehran and Washington.

Considering that Oct, just about 3 dozen deadly rocket attacks have hit US military and diplomatic installations in Iraq, with the US blaming professional-Tehran faction Kataeb Hezbollah.

Infuriated, Washington has demanded Iraq acquire tougher action to hold the perpetrators accountable and Thursday’s unprecedented raid appeared to be a response to this get in touch with.

Just ahead of midnight Thursday, the elite Counter-Terrorism Services stormed a foundation in southern Baghdad employed by Kataeb Hezbollah, also acknowledged as Brigade 45 of the Hashed al-Shaabi pressure, Iraqi officers and security resources explained.

They advised AFP that much more than a dozen Kataeb fighters were being arrested, but an official statement from Iraq’s Joint Operations Command (JOC) on Friday did not specify which team had been targeted.

It claimed the operation was based mostly on intelligence about a planned assault on the Environmentally friendly Zone, where the US embassy and other overseas missions, authorities structures and UN places of work are located.

“Fourteen folks were arrested and evidence of the criminal offense confiscated, including two rocket launchers,” the JOC assertion mentioned.

The raid is the boldest act still in opposition to Tehran-backed teams primarily based in Iraq, which has extensive had to wander a great line involving its two major allies, Iran and the US.

Washington is pursuing a “greatest strain” campaign in opposition to Tehran and sees teams like Kataeb Hezbollah as a dangerous extension of Iran’s influence.

The US has blamed Kataeb for rockets that have killed a number of United kingdom, American and Iraqi forces given that October.

But Kataeb has been nominally built-in into the Iraqi state, and former primary minister Adel Abdel Mahdi hesitated to just take robust action in opposition to the group.

These types of calculations seem to have improved underneath new Prime Minister Mustafa al-Kadhemi, viewed by Washington as a helpful determine but despised by Kataeb.

The team accuses Kadhemi of complicity in the US killing of Iranian typical Qasem Soleimani and Hashed deputy main Abu Mahdi al-Muhandis in January.

“This monster named Kadhemi needed to shuffle the cards to cover his participation in the legal murder of two martyrs and their comrades, presenting a new token of his collaboration with his American overlords,” Kataeb spokesman Abu Ali al-Askari stated just after Thursday’s raid.

“We lie in wait around,” he warned.

Subsequent the raid, “federal government cars” experienced tried to encompass CTS headquarters, according to the JOC statement.

– Interrogations begin –

The JOC statement also explained Iraq’s judiciary experienced issued arrest warrants for Thursday’s operation below the counter-terrorism legislation, which carries the loss of life penalty.

But it continues to be unclear exactly which authority will be accountable for bringing to trial or sentencing the suspects.

“They are becoming interrogated by the Hashed safety apparatus and will show up in advance of a Hashed judge,” a supply from the Hashed’s stability pressure advised AFP.

“They are pressuring us to release them,” the source claimed.

There was no comment from Kadhemi’s business office or from the US, but Iraqi skilled Hisham al-Hashemi stated Washington and the anti-jihadist alliance it leads in Iraq would be delighted.

“The intercontinental coalition is happy with this stage. Just storming these headquarters is adequate for it,” he explained.

He mentioned Kadhemi would also restore some of his community ratings, which had plummeted in response to unpopular austerity measures aimed at fighting off the economic collapse triggered by a crash in oil price ranges.

Kataeb Hezbollah to start with started combating US troops in 2003 in the course of the American-led invasion to topple Saddam Hussein and is the best armed Iraqi ally of Iran’s Groundbreaking Guard Corps, in accordance to professional Michael Knights.

The CTS, in the meantime, was set up by US profession forces pursuing 2003 and is mostly seen as a professional-US power.

In just one of his first acts as premier, Kadhemi reappointed Abdulwahab al-Saadi, also found as US-welcoming, as CTS head.

Kadhemi then introduced a strategic dialogue with Washington to discuss military, financial and tradition problems.

As component of the talks, the US pledged to keep on decreasing the number of US troops in Iraq, based mostly there to guide a world-wide coalition helping battle jihadist sleeper cells.

Iraq, meanwhile, promised to keep the perpetrators of the rocket attacks accountable and Kadhemi not long ago convened his countrywide stability council to attract up a system.

The get started of the talks coincided with a substantial spike in missile attacks, with six incidents targeting American installations over the last two weeks.

The escalation shattered the relative tranquil that experienced settled in given that March, after a period of specifically higher tensions concerning Iran and the US spilt in excess of into Iraq.

Pursuing the US strike on Soleimani, Iraq’s parliament voted to oust foreign forces, Iran released ballistic missiles against American troops and the Hashed vowed revenge.
